NIJ\u2019s performance standard has been revised seven times since the first version was published in 1972 by our precursor agency, the National Institute of Law Enforcement and Criminal Justice. Periodic updates allow NIJ to keep pace with the ever-evolving weapons threats that law enforcement officers encounter. The most recent performance standard, NIJ Standard 0101.07, The Ballistic Resistance of Body Armor, was released in October 2023, the first update since July 2008 (see Figure 1).<\/p>\n<p>In this iteration of the standard, NIJ harmonized laboratory testing procedures and practices relevant to ballistic testing. The work was a collaboration among several agencies, including the U.S. Army, the National Institute of Standards and Technology, ballistics laboratories, body armor manufacturers, materials suppliers, and other stakeholders. Over several years, these groups produced a suite of testing methods and laboratory practices through ASTM International, a standards developer that publishes thousands of standards for many industries. NIJ used the ASTM standards as the building blocks of NIJ Standard 0101.07, adding improvements to the test methods for armor designed for women. It also augmented the testing of how well the armor resists penetration and how deeply a bullet can deform the vest, which can cause blunt force injuries to officers even when the vest isn\u2019t fully penetrated.<\/p>\n<p>NIJ also administers a body armor certification program, the Compliance Testing Program, to test commercially available products for protection against common handgun, rifle, and stab threats. Accredited labs test products for compliance and determine whether the products meet NIJ\u2019s minimum performance standards. If a product is compliant, NIJ adds it to the Compliant Products List and the product is allowed to display the NIJ trademarked seal (see Figure 2). If law enforcement agencies do not know to check for the NIJ seal and do not refer to the Compliant Products List before they purchase equipment, entire police forces could be in the line of fire without properly vetted protection.<sup>3<\/sup><\/p>\n<p>Programs like the Patrick Leahy Bulletproof Vest Partnership help reinforce the importance of properly vetted gear by reimbursing states, local governments, and federally recognized tribes for up to 50 percent of the cost of body armor vests purchased for law enforcement officers, but only if the vests are on the Compliant Products List.<\/p>\n<blockquote><p><span style=\"color: #0071b9;\">It is imperative that officers wear the appropriate gear for the threats they are most likely to face.<\/span><\/p><\/blockquote>\n<p>Checking the Compliant Products List is also the best way to ensure that vests are appropriate for the specific needs of the officers they are meant to protect. For example, corrections officers are more likely to require stab-resistant armor, tactical units may require hard plates in their vests, and shift officers often need soft body armor. Procurement officers should understand that just because a product is compliant with one kind of threat, it will not be equally resistant to all types of threats. Each product is separately tested for the many different types of threats law enforcement officers encounter. It is imperative that officers wear the appropriate gear for the threats they are most likely to face.<\/p>\n<p>A few months ago, Sheriff\u2019s Deputy Joe Kill of the Ramsey County, Minnesota, Law Enforcement Center was shot while in pursuit of a suspect.<sup>4<\/sup> Like Officer Carrizales, Deputy Kill\u2019s body armor absorbed shrapnel from rifle fire; although the shot displaced his ribs, his vest spared his life.
